Job Description

Controlled Products Systems Group (CPSG), an affiliate of Chamberlain Group, is a one-stop distributor of access control and perimeter security products for professional dealers and installers across residential, commercial, and industrial markets. With a personal approach to business, our employees—whether in one of our branches nationwide or at our corporate office—are committed to serving our customers and supplier partners with dedication and expertise.

About Chamberlain Group

Chamberlain Group (CG) is a global leader in intelligent access and Blackstone portfolio company. Powered by our myQ technology, we make access simple and secure for millions of homeowners, businesses, and communities worldwide. Our flagship brands, LiftMaster® and Chamberlain® , are found in 50+ million homes, and 12 million+ people rely on the myQ® app daily.
